暂无图片
暂无图片
暂无图片
暂无图片
暂无图片

GBase 8s SQL 指南:教程_5 在 SELECT 语句中使用函数_5.1 在 SELECT 语句中使用函数(4)

GBASE数据库 2021-12-20
519

MONTH 函数
下列查询使用 MONTH 函数来抽取和显示在哪个月份接收和处理客户来电,并且它将对结
果列使用显式标签。但是,它不区分年份。
图: 查询

图: 查询结果



如果 DAY 比当前日期早,那么下列查询使用 MONTH 函数和 DAY 及 CURRENT 来显示在
哪个月份接收和处理客户来电。
图: 查询

图: 查询结果

WEEKDAY 函数
下列查询使用 WEEKDAY 函数来指示在星期几接收并处理来电(0 表示星期日,1 表示星
期一,以此类推),并标记表达式列。
图: 查询

图: 查询结果



下列查询使用 COUNT 和 WEEKDAY 函数来对在周末收到的来电进行计数。此类语句能够
使您了解客户来电模式或指示是否需要加班费。
图: 查询

图: 查询结果

YEAR 函数
下列查询检索 call_dtime 比当前年份的开始早的行。
图: 程序

图: 查询结果

格式化 DATETIME 值
在下列查询中,EXTEND 函数仅显示指定的子字段以限制两个 DATETIME 值。
图: 程序



该查询为标签为 call_time 和 res_time 的列返回月份至分钟范围,提供工作量的指示。
图: 查询结果

TO_CHAR 函数也可以格式化 DATETIME 值。有关内置函数的信息,请参阅 TO_CHAR
函数,该函数也可接受作为参数的 DATE 值或数字值并返回格式化的字符串。
除了这些示例说明的内置时间函数之外,GBase 8s 还支持 ADD_MONTHS 、LAST_DAY 、
MDY 、MONTHS_BETWEEN 、NEXT_DAY 和QUARTER 函数。除了这些函数,
TRUNC 和 ROUND 函数也可返回更改 DATE 或 DATETIME 参数精度的值。这些附加时
间函数在 GBase 8s SQL 指南:语法中进行了描述。

「喜欢这篇文章,您的关注和赞赏是给作者最好的鼓励」
关注作者
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文章的来源(墨天轮),文章链接,文章作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论